I'm currently applying, and I'm a WICHE applicant. I couldn't find anywhere in the AADSAS application where you're supposed to disclose that you're a WICHE applicant. So I emailed AADSAS and asked them if there was some type of box to check or something, and I received this response, "If you are a WICHE applicant, you can address that in your "Disadvantaged
section" since there are no working dental schools in the area and that is a
disadvantage." Well, in Arizona, there are two dental schools... so I'm not sure I feel comfortable putting that, because it may be kind of misleading in my particular case. So I guess what I'm asking is... what should I do? Do school's ask about it in the secondary applications, or should I go ahead and mention it in the "disadvantaged section"? I just don't understand how I'm supposed to let schools know that I'm a WICHE applicant...?
